What is the average diameter of the babies up for auction, and how do you pack and protect them for shipment? thankx!!!
May 30th, 2012 at 11:05:33 AM PDT by
Original
They average 3/4 to 1 inch across the root area. I wait til the day of shipping before cutting. I wrap the root section in a damp paper towel and then wrap in plastic. I put the prepared baby in a small box and then an envelope! They are protected from being bruised and crushed. You can plant them sraight into pot or root them in water for a few weeks. I water mine almost every evening because she is outside and loving it!
